As Miami enjoys partly cloudy skies today with a comfortable temperature hovering around 69°F, locals can expect mostly sunny weather with a high near 75°F. It seems the sun has found favor on the city with only a slight breeze from the northeast fanning through at speeds up to 14 mph, and gusts possibly reaching 21 mph, according to the latest update from the National Weather Service.

As the evening draws in, the forecast promises a mostly clear night with temperatures dipping gently to around 67°F. It would appear that the weather intends to slowly shift, allowing even warmer weather to make its advance later in the week. NBC 6 Miami suggests that highs will climb, possibly reaching the lower 80s come Thursday.

For those longing for a bit more warmth, Wednesday is not to disappoint with the mercury expected to rise slightly to a high near 78°F, per National Weather Service reports. By the time Wednesday night comes around, we are to enjoy partly cloudy skies and a low around 70°F, maintaining the streak of pleasant evenings.

Come later in the week, humidity is anticipated to make a decided return, and with it, a slight increase in rain chances up to the 20-30% range for Friday and into the weekend. This is coupled with a continued warm-up, as residents can look forward to mostly sunny skies with the highs steadily climbing, reaching a peak near 83°F by Friday, as reported by NBC 6 Miami.

Ahead lies a weekend that promises more sun than shadow, with mostly sunny days and partly cloudy nights maintaining the South Florida charm. With steadily increasing temperatures, the narrative of the week seems to be one of gradual ascension toward a warmer, almost summery ambiance, with early forecasts predicting a consistent high around 81°F for the impending days.
